This is a summary of the southern hemisphere atmospheric circulation patterns and meteorological indices for summer 2017-18; an account of seasonal rainfall and temperature for the Australian region is also provided. A short-lived and weak La Nina developed but decayed by the end of February 2018. Sea-surface temperatures were exceptionally warm in the Tasman Sea from late 2017 to early 2018. It was an exceptionally warm summer for Australia, and the third-warmest mean temperature on record for the nation. Summer rainfall was close to the long-term average for Australia, with above average rainfall in west and below-average rainfall in the east.
